Ako to funguje?

U

ukapil

Guest
**************
Vždy @ (($ time-time_cs_start)> `tCEM) begin
$ Display ( "max tCEM porušenie", $ time);
$ Display ( "time_cs_start =% t", time_cs_start);
koniec
**************

`tCEM = 4000ns

Je pozorované, že keď $ time = 5 ns & time_cs_start = 5 ns, vstúpi v bloku vždy.

Prosím, vysvetlite mi, fungovanie vždy bloku.

thnx,
ukapil

 
Prosím, pri posielaní tieto otázky mohli byť konkrétnejší?
Čo mám na mysli ...
Simulátor, na ktorých máte tento problém?
Čo bolo simulátor verzia?
Čo je to typ pre "time_cs_st" premenné?
Čo je to "časovom horizonte??Added po 14 minútach:prvý "time_cs_start" by mal byť declaired ako typu času.
blok je vždy hodnotená Evry, keď dôjde na akciu signálov v
citlivosť zoznamu.Tu v ur citlivosti zozname $ dobe je funkcia a
"tCEM je konštantná len signál máte, je time_cs_start
Takže kedykoľvek zmeny (udalosti na signálu) vždy blok v ur kód
majú vykonávať.I doubght time_cs_start sa mení na 5 ns na 5ns.

 
To je ok, ale prečo je potrebné zadať vždy, keď bloku $ time = 5 ns & time_cs_start = 5 ns?

 

Welcome to EDABoard.com

Sponsor

Back
Top